A TV series from the 1970s, "The Six Million Dollar Man," imagines a former astronaut with bionic implants and superhuman strength acting as a secret agent for the government. Such enhancement of human abilities with artificial components (all at a reasonable price tag) might resonate with some of today's scientists who are working on a more modest goal of augmenting the properties of cells and biological systems. Their aim is to design new synthetic routes for compounds and even create completely new molecules that may not exist in nature by exploiting the versatility of the life's systems.
